Antony Starr and Erin Moriarty's collaboration on the hit television series The Boys has solidified their places as prominent figures in contemporary television. Starr embodies the terrifyingly charismatic Homelander, leader of the seemingly altruistic superhero group, the Seven. Moriarty, on the other hand, portrays Annie January, also known as Starlight, a naive and idealistic young woman who joins the Seven, only to discover the dark reality beneath the surface. This sets the stage for a compelling dynamic between their characters, a relationship that forms a cornerstone of the show's narrative.

Within the narrative of The Boys, the bond between Homelander and Starlight is anything but simple. At first, Homelander is drawn to Starlight's perceived innocence and unwavering belief in the superhero ideal. He sees her as a malleable figure, someone he can mold to fit his own agenda. This initial attraction soon morphs into resentment as Starlight's own popularity and moral compass begin to challenge Homelander's authority and warped worldview. Starlight, initially awestruck by Homelander's powerful presence and celebrity status, gradually uncovers his true nature: a deeply disturbed, manipulative, and ultimately, sociopathic individual. This dramatic shift in her perception forms the core of her character arc and significantly impacts the overarching storyline.

The saga of Homelander and Starlight stands out as one of the most multifaceted and captivating elements of The Boys. It is an ever-evolving narrative filled with unanticipated developments and profound revelations.

Initially, Homelander finds himself drawn to Starlight's inherent purity and idealistic outlook. He perceives her as a refreshing contrast to the pervasive cynicism and moral decay that he observes within the world. However, as the storyline unfolds, Homelander's sentiments toward Starlight undergo a transformation. He becomes increasingly envious of her burgeoning fame and influence, ultimately viewing her as a potential impediment to his own authority and dominance.

Starlight, in turn, initially holds Homelander in high regard, impressed by his commanding presence and formidable strength. However, she eventually comes to recognize his true nature as a perilous and calculating sociopath. She comes to the sobering realization that Homelander is far from the heroic figure she once envisioned, and she begins to fear for her own well-being.The dynamic between Homelander and Starlight is intricate, replete with unforeseen turns and startling disclosures.
